  • Booti Booti National Park: This stunning national park, located 9.7km from Wallingat, offers breathtaking scenery and a range of outdoor adventures. Explore its lush trails, pristine beaches, and diverse wildlife, making it a perfect spot for hiking and picnicking.
  • Wallis Lake: Just 4.8km away, Wallis Lake is a picturesque escape known for its serene beaches and stunning views. Ideal for romantic strolls, water sports, or simply soaking up the sun, this lake provides a tranquil setting for outdoor enthusiasts.
  • Whoota Whoota Lookout: Situated within Wallingat, this lookout offers a spectacular vantage point for breathtaking views of the surrounding landscape. Whether you're seeking adventure or a romantic sunset, Whoota Whoota Lookout is a must-visit destination.

Best time to go to Wallingat

The best time to visit Wallingat is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. January is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

What's the seasonal weather like in Wallingat?
The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 22°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 14°C. Average annual precipitation for Wallingat is 1127 mm.
